Researchers from an unnamed institution released a study on how different reviewer guidelines impact AI-based automated peer review. The study, published on arXiv, compared official conference guidelines with reviewer-imitating guidelines generated by large language models (LLMs) from high-quality human reviews.

Official Guidelines Outperform LLM-Generated Ones

The researchers conducted experiments to evaluate the effectiveness of different reviewer guidelines. They found that official conference guidelines produced review results most consistent with human judgments. This indicates that evaluation criteria refined through conference practice are more effective in guiding AI-based peer review.
